What are motels like?
Motels often have free parking, and many also feature an outdoor pool. Often one or two stories tall, motel properties usually have outdoor access to guestrooms from the parking lot. Starting in the early 1950s, colorful neon signs were used as beacons for tired families on road trips, and today, examples of these can still be found along historic U.S. Route 66.
What can I do in Laurel Hill?
Some outdoorsy places nearby include Lake Wallace, Hitchcock Creek Trail, and Lake Paul Wallace. You’ll find these family-friendly sights in the area: Carolina Horse Park, National Railroad Museum, and Hamlet Passenger Depot. While you’re checking out the area, consider visiting Rockingham Speedway, Rockingham Dragway, and Marlboro Country Club.
What's the seasonal weather like in Laurel Hill?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Laurel Hill to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 78°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 48°F. Average annual precipitation for Laurel Hill is 50 inches.
